As they consider your potential acceptance into their medical school, the interviewers at Drexel University would like to understand the types of schools you are interested in. Knowing where you are applying will help them determine if Drexel University will meet your specific needs and educational desires or goals.

"After careful review of all of the programs throughout the country, I have applied to four other medical schools focusing here on the east coast. Those schools are A, B, C, and D. My interest in Drexel University is strong because of your fantastic reputation and the sheer success of your graduates."

You should be transparent when answering this question, but avoid saying anything offensive, such as 'this school is my last choice.' Determine the number one reason you want to attend Drexel University and focus on that.
